How To Grow A Plumbing Business : Laying the Foundations

Industry Certification and Licensing

Ensure your plumbing business complies with all industry regulations by obtaining the necessary certifications and licenses. This establishes credibility and instills trust in customers, assuring them that your team possesses the required skills and qualifications.

Business Plan Development

Craft a detailed business plan outlining your goals, target market, competitive landscape, and financial projections. A well-thought-out plan serves as a roadmap for growth, guiding your decisions and strategies.

Building a Skilled Team

Recruitment of Qualified Plumbers

Assemble a team of skilled and licensed plumbers. Invest in the recruitment of qualified professionals who align with your business values. A competent and reliable team is the backbone of a successful plumbing business.

Continuous Training Programs

Implement continuous training programs to update your team on the latest plumbing technologies, techniques, and safety practices. Ongoing education enhances your plumbers’ skill set and contributes to your services’ overall excellence.

Effective Marketing Strategies

Online Presence and Website Development

Establish a solid online presence by developing a professional website. Optimize the website for search engines to enhance visibility. A well-designed website is a virtual storefront providing essential information to potential customers.

Social Media Engagement

Leverage social media platforms to connect with your local community. Share success stories and tips for home maintenance, and engage with customers. Social media is a powerful tool for building brand awareness and fostering community relationships.

Customer Service Excellence

Responsive Communication

Prioritize responsive communication with customers. Timely responses to inquiries, transparent pricing, and clear explanations contribute to a positive customer experience. Exceptional customer service builds trust and encourages repeat business.

Customer Feedback and Reviews

Actively seek customer feedback and encourage reviews. Positive reviews enhance your business reputation, while constructive feedback provides insights for improvement. Utilize customer testimonials in your marketing efforts to showcase your service quality.

Plumbing Business : Diversifying Services

Expanded Service Offerings

Explore opportunities to diversify your services. This could include offering emergency plumbing services, water heater installations, or even introducing eco-friendly solutions. Diversification enhances your market appeal and revenue streams.

Maintenance Programs

Implement maintenance programs to provide ongoing services to customers. Regular check-ups, plumbing inspections, and preventive maintenance contracts create recurring revenue and strengthen customer relationships.

Strategic Partnerships

Collaborations with Contractors and Builders

Forge collaborations with contractors and builders in your local area. Establishing partnerships can lead to referrals for plumbing services in new construction projects or renovations. Networking within the construction industry expands your business reach.

Partnerships with Real Estate Agencies

Form partnerships with local real estate agencies. As a preferred plumbing service provider, you may be recommended for inspections, repairs, or installations during property transactions. Building relationships within the real estate sector can result in consistent business opportunities.

Efficient Operations and Technology Integration

Utilization of Plumbing Software

Integrate plumbing software to streamline operations. Software solutions can assist with scheduling, invoicing, and customer management. Leveraging technology enhances efficiency and allows for better organization of your plumbing business.

Investment in Modern Equipment

Stay updated with the latest plumbing equipment and technologies. Investing in modern tools improves the efficiency of your services and positions your business as forward-thinking and technologically adept.

Customer Retention Strategies

Membership Programs and Loyalty Rewards

Implement membership programs or loyalty rewards for repeat customers. Offering discounts, priority scheduling, or exclusive promotions encourages customers to choose your services consistently.

Regular Customer Engagement

Regularly engage with your customer base through newsletters, email updates, or seasonal promotions. Staying in touch keeps your business top of mind, and customers are likelier to turn to you for their plumbing needs.

Community Engagement Initiatives

Sponsorship of Local Events or Teams

Contribute to your community by sponsoring local events or sports teams. This enhances your brand visibility and fosters a positive image as a community-focused business.

Educational Workshops or Webinars

Host educational workshops or webinars on plumbing maintenance, water conservation, or other relevant topics. You provide valuable information to the community and position your business as an authority in plumbing matters.

Financial Management and Growth Planning

Budgeting for Expansion

Develop a budget that allocates funds for business expansion. This could include marketing initiatives, additional staff, or investments in technology. Strategic budgeting ensures that your business is prepared for growth.

Financial Analysis and Performance Metrics

Regularly analyze financial performance metrics to assess the health of your plumbing business. Understanding key indicators such as profit margins, customer acquisition costs, and cash flow enables informed decision-making.

Green Plumbing Solutions

Stay abreast of industry trends, including the growing demand for eco-friendly plumbing solutions. Green plumbing services, such as water-efficient fixtures or sustainable practices, align with environmentally conscious consumer preferences.

Smart Home Integration

Explore opportunities for smart home integration in plumbing services. Intelligent technologies like leak detection systems or programmable thermostats appeal to homeowners seeking modern and efficient plumbing solutions.

Scaling Your Plumbing Business

Geographic Expansion

Consider geographic expansion by opening additional branches or servicing neighboring areas. Expanding your service area increases your customer base and market reach.

Franchise Opportunities

Explore franchise opportunities for your plumbing business. Franchising allows you to replicate your successful business model in new locations while benefiting from established branding.

Plumbing Business FAQs

1. What steps should I take to become a licensed plumber for my business?

To become a licensed plumber, you must complete a plumbing apprenticeship, gain practical experience, and pass a licensing exam. Check local regulations for specific requirements.

2. How can I attract qualified plumbers to join my team?

Attract qualified plumbers by offering competitive salaries, benefits, and a positive work environment. Highlight opportunities for professional development and career advancement.

3. What marketing strategies are effective for promoting a plumbing business?

Effective marketing strategies for a plumbing business include building a professional website, engaging on social media, utilizing local SEO, and implementing targeted advertising. Highlighting positive customer reviews also contributes to a robust online presence.

4. How can I differentiate my plumbing business in a competitive market?

Differentiate your business by emphasizing exceptional customer service, offering diverse services, and showcasing your team’s expertise. Clear communication, transparent pricing, and a commitment to quality set your business apart in a competitive market.

5. What technology can help streamline plumbing business operations?

Technology solutions such as plumbing software for scheduling and invoicing, modern tools for efficient repairs, and smart home integration can streamline plumbing business operations. These tools enhance efficiency, organization, and customer service.
